Florence, 18 June 2024 – Fire in a technical room of shopping center Esselunga in via Antonio Gramsci a Sesto Fiorentino. This morning, June 18, the flames and smoke, for reasons still being ascertained, affected the second basement floor of the building: the entire building was evacuated as a precaution. According to what was found by Arpat technicians, the flames broke out in the technical room where the compressors of the refrigeration systems are housed, while maintenance work was underway.

The call to the firefighters of the Florence command went out at 9.30, with the Fi-Ovest detachment team on site. They entered the room filled with combustion fumes and put out the fire. The air tank was also sent to the site to support the team and to ventilate the rooms. Long operations to make the premises affected by the fire safe, for which 3 tankers were used, one from the fire brigade command of Lawn. The technicians Arpatafter the relevant findings, advised those who live near the shopping center to keep the windows closed and limit outdoor exposure.

The support of the ladder truck is also essential to allow the evacuation of two workers on the roof of the building to carry out maintenance work, which due to the presence of fumes were unable to descend from the stairwell. The intervention of health personnel and the official to coordinate the rescue operations was requested on site as a precaution.

The previous

In this same period, three years ago, a fire another shopping center, the Coop one in Ponte a Greve, was devastated. Fortunately no one was involved or injured, but there was great fear due to the black smoke and very high flames that destroyed the structure. The firefighters, who promptly intervened inside the structure, tried to limit the damage by working non-stop for days. Since June 3, 2021, the date on which the flames broke out, the supermarket reopened on March 3 of the following year.
